1
0

Compare commits

..

17 Commits

Author SHA256 Message Date
Ana Guerrero
9485c12f8c Accepting request 1228024 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1228024
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=27
2024-12-03 19:47:52 +00:00
537b96d33a [info=1b37677994e76bf875d8812f51c724d7]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=268
2024-12-03 13:54:25 +00:00
Dominique Leuenberger
cd607f5f19 Accepting request 1219652 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1219652
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=26
2024-10-30 21:57:47 +00:00
Dominique Leuenberger
998a759c27 Accepting request 1219145 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1219145
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=25
2024-10-30 16:35:49 +00:00
f08dbb4086 [info=484fe4eafe0a41a0d8e242f35ad10016]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=250
2024-10-30 15:42:46 +00:00
b1d2abb627 [info=67fff82fb0dc7da47f924d23170ad2ad]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=248
2024-10-29 15:35:07 +00:00
Ana Guerrero
702c056f6c Accepting request 1207912 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1207912
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=24
2024-10-15 12:59:36 +00:00
f3f2836c93 [info=910f4dc43c2ab046d4ad02c6763c7aa2]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=241
2024-10-14 11:34:56 +00:00
Dominique Leuenberger
3a6b5d7a97 Accepting request 1207291 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1207291
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=23
2024-10-14 11:20:56 +00:00
ba59a56f58 [info=b6505ee7f8c9ba11d0c5715adcc4cbfa]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=240
2024-10-11 15:28:15 +00:00
Ana Guerrero
1540f14a7d Accepting request 1203699 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1203699
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=22
2024-09-26 16:53:36 +00:00
Ana Guerrero
8e325d07de Accepting request 1203119 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1203119
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=21
2024-09-25 19:53:41 +00:00
f21edc06c6 [info=94732e12f02db7f254a88b5d9617ee07]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=231
2024-09-25 17:59:04 +00:00
53407c4cca [info=9bb9cbc4106ed6b8f27ebd79c085281b]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=230
2024-09-25 17:19:54 +00:00
a62fb5371a [info=3ac2225cff5c8d02157f6c8c64ddb655]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=227
2024-09-24 20:06:33 +00:00
Ana Guerrero
f50ca93e51 Accepting request 1200621 from devel:BCI:Tumbleweed
🤖: sync package with devel:BCI:Tumbleweed from OBS

OBS-URL: https://build.opensuse.org/request/show/1200621
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/python-3.10-image?expand=0&rev=20
2024-09-12 14:58:26 +00:00
53829d4ce0 [info=4cb126d6f2b7546bf95eea19f15f97be]
OBS-URL: https://build.opensuse.org/package/show/devel:BCI:Tumbleweed/python-3.10-image?expand=0&rev=215
2024-09-12 10:47:20 +00:00
3 changed files with 57 additions and 11 deletions

View File

@ -13,21 +13,22 @@
# Please submit bugfixes or comments via https://bugs.opensuse.org/ # Please submit bugfixes or comments via https://bugs.opensuse.org/
# You can contact the BCI team via https://github.com/SUSE/bci/discussions # You can contact the BCI team via https://github.com/SUSE/bci/discussions
#!UseOBSRepositories
#!BuildTag: opensuse/bci/python:3.10
#!BuildTag: opensuse/bci/python:3.10-%RELEASE%
#!BuildTag: opensuse/bci/python:3
#!BuildTag: opensuse/bci/python:3-%RELEASE%
#!BuildTag: opensuse/bci/python:%%py310_ver%%
#!BuildTag: opensuse/bci/python:%%py310_ver%%-%RELEASE% #!BuildTag: opensuse/bci/python:%%py310_ver%%-%RELEASE%
#!BuildTag: opensuse/bci/python:%%py310_ver%%
#!BuildTag: opensuse/bci/python:3.10
#!BuildTag: opensuse/bci/python:3
FROM opensuse/tumbleweed:latest FROM opensuse/tumbleweed:latest
RUN set -euo pipefail; zypper -n in --no-recommends python310-devel python310 python310-pip curl findutils gawk git-core procps util-linux python310-wheel python310-pipx; zypper -n clean; rm -rf /var/log/{lastlog,tallylog,zypper.log,zypp/history,YaST2} RUN set -euo pipefail; \
zypper -n install --no-recommends python310-devel python310 python310-pip curl findutils gawk git-core procps util-linux python310-wheel python310-pipx; \
zypper -n clean; \
rm -rf {/target,}/var/log/{alternatives.log,lastlog,tallylog,zypper.log,zypp/history,YaST2}
# Define labels according to https://en.opensuse.org/Building_derived_containers # Define labels according to https://en.opensuse.org/Building_derived_containers
# labelprefix=org.opensuse.bci.python # labelprefix=org.opensuse.bci.python
LABEL org.opencontainers.image.authors="openSUSE (https://www.opensuse.org/)"
LABEL org.opencontainers.image.title="openSUSE Tumbleweed BCI Python 3.10 development" LABEL org.opencontainers.image.title="openSUSE Tumbleweed BCI Python 3.10 development"
LABEL org.opencontainers.image.description="Python 3.10 development container based on the openSUSE Tumbleweed Base Container Image." LABEL org.opencontainers.image.description="Python 3.10 development container based on the openSUSE Tumbleweed Base Container Image."
LABEL org.opencontainers.image.version="%%py310_ver%%" LABEL org.opencontainers.image.version="%%py310_ver%%"
@ -35,8 +36,8 @@ LABEL org.opencontainers.image.url="https://www.opensuse.org"
LABEL org.opencontainers.image.created="%BUILDTIME%" LABEL org.opencontainers.image.created="%BUILDTIME%"
LABEL org.opencontainers.image.vendor="openSUSE Project" LABEL org.opencontainers.image.vendor="openSUSE Project"
LABEL org.opencontainers.image.source="%SOURCEURL%" LABEL org.opencontainers.image.source="%SOURCEURL%"
LABEL org.opencontainers.image.ref.name="3.10-%RELEASE%" LABEL org.opencontainers.image.ref.name="%%py310_ver%%-%RELEASE%"
LABEL org.opensuse.reference="registry.opensuse.org/opensuse/bci/python:3.10-%RELEASE%" LABEL org.opensuse.reference="registry.opensuse.org/opensuse/bci/python:%%py310_ver%%-%RELEASE%"
LABEL org.openbuildservice.disturl="%DISTURL%" LABEL org.openbuildservice.disturl="%DISTURL%"
LABEL org.opensuse.lifecycle-url="https://en.opensuse.org/Lifetime#openSUSE_BCI" LABEL org.opensuse.lifecycle-url="https://en.opensuse.org/Lifetime#openSUSE_BCI"
LABEL org.opensuse.release-stage="released" LABEL org.opensuse.release-stage="released"

View File

@ -1,12 +1,12 @@
<services> <services>
<service mode="buildtime" name="docker_label_helper"/> <service mode="buildtime" name="docker_label_helper"/>
<service mode="buildtime" name="kiwi_metainfo_helper"/> <service mode="buildtime" name="kiwi_metainfo_helper"/>
<service name="replace_using_package_version" mode="buildtime"> <service mode="buildtime" name="replace_using_package_version">
<param name="file">Dockerfile</param> <param name="file">Dockerfile</param>
<param name="regex">%%py310_ver%%</param> <param name="regex">%%py310_ver%%</param>
<param name="package">python310-base</param> <param name="package">python310-base</param>
</service> </service>
<service name="replace_using_package_version" mode="buildtime"> <service mode="buildtime" name="replace_using_package_version">
<param name="file">Dockerfile</param> <param name="file">Dockerfile</param>
<param name="regex">%%pip_ver%%</param> <param name="regex">%%pip_ver%%</param>
<param name="package">python310-pip</param> <param name="package">python310-pip</param>

View File

@ -1,3 +1,48 @@
-------------------------------------------------------------------
Tue Dec 3 13:26:37 UTC 2024 - SUSE Update Bot <bci-internal@suse.de>
- Change attribute order in _service
-------------------------------------------------------------------
Wed Oct 30 15:34:45 UTC 2024 - SUSE Update Bot <bci-internal@suse.de>
- remove nonsensical org.opencontainers.image.authors - duplication of .vendor
-------------------------------------------------------------------
Tue Oct 29 15:23:20 UTC 2024 - SUSE Update Bot <bci-internal@suse.de>
- drop tag_version-%RELEASE%
-------------------------------------------------------------------
Mon Oct 14 11:26:26 UTC 2024 - SUSE Update Bot <bci-internal@suse.de>
- make the version-%release tag the first one listed; remove duplicates where they existed; update image.ref/reference to point to the version-%release(-) tag
-------------------------------------------------------------------
Fri Oct 11 15:12:52 UTC 2024 - SUSE Update Bot <bci-internal@suse.de>
- make the tag with -%RELEASE% the first tag listed
-------------------------------------------------------------------
Wed Sep 25 17:36:16 UTC 2024 - Dirk Mueller <dmueller@suse.com>
- rerender installation step in multiple lines, allow uninstalling optional packages
-------------------------------------------------------------------
Wed Sep 25 17:12:11 UTC 2024 - Dirk Mueller <dmueller@suse.com>
- improved log cleaning
-------------------------------------------------------------------
Tue Sep 24 20:00:32 UTC 2024 - Dirk Mueller <dmueller@suse.com>
- remove release tags for additional_versions
-------------------------------------------------------------------
Thu Sep 12 10:37:22 UTC 2024 - Dirk Mueller <dmueller@suse.com>
- set useobsrepositories explicitly
------------------------------------------------------------------- -------------------------------------------------------------------
Fri Sep 6 11:30:01 UTC 2024 - Dirk Mueller <dmueller@suse.com> Fri Sep 6 11:30:01 UTC 2024 - Dirk Mueller <dmueller@suse.com>